Desmos viridiflorus Saff. (1912:506)

 

 

Taxonomy & Nomenclature

Synonym/s: Unona viridiflora Bedd. in Icon. Pl. Ind. Or.: 34 (1874), nom. illeg.

 

Conservation Status

Last record: 15 May 1903 (Nayar & Sastry, 1987:24 [as 1903]; Eganathan, 1997:836 [as 15 May 1903])

Rediscovered on 6 April 1995 (Eganathan, 1997:836)

 

Distribution

Kerala & Tamil Nadu, India
